Leggett & Platt, Inc. (LEG) is a publicly traded Consumer Cyclical sector company. As of May 21, 2026, LEG trades at $9.78 with a market cap of $1.27B and a P/E ratio of 5.97. LEG moved +5.63% today. Year to date, LEG is -11.49%; over the trailing twelve months it is +6.65%. Its 52-week range spans $6.48 to $14.24. Analyst consensus is neutral with an average price target of $11.50. What do analysts rate LEG?

3 analysts cover LEG: 0 strong buy, 0 buy, 3 hold, 0 sell, and 0 strong sell. The consensus rating is neutral. The average price target is $11.50.
